private static TailType getReturnTail(PsiElement position) {
    PsiElement scope = position;
    while (true) {
      if (scope instanceof PsiFile || scope instanceof PsiClassInitializer) {
        return TailType.NONE;
      }

      if (scope instanceof PsiMethod) {
        final PsiMethod method = (PsiMethod) scope;
        if (method.isConstructor() || PsiType.VOID.equals(method.getReturnType())) {
          return TailType.SEMICOLON;
        }

        return TailType.HUMBLE_SPACE_BEFORE_WORD;
      }
      if (scope instanceof PsiLambdaExpression) {
        final PsiType returnType =
            LambdaUtil.getFunctionalInterfaceReturnType(((PsiLambdaExpression) scope));
        if (PsiType.VOID.equals(returnType)) {
          return TailType.SEMICOLON;
        }
        return TailType.HUMBLE_SPACE_BEFORE_WORD;
      }
      scope = scope.getParent();
    }
  }
  public static String checkReturnType(
      PsiMethodReferenceExpression expression,
      JavaResolveResult result,
      PsiType functionalInterfaceType) {
    final PsiElement resolve = result.getElement();
    if (resolve instanceof PsiMethod) {
      final PsiClass containingClass = ((PsiMethod) resolve).getContainingClass();
      LOG.assertTrue(containingClass != null);
      PsiSubstitutor subst = result.getSubstitutor();
      PsiClass qContainingClass = getQualifierResolveResult(expression).getContainingClass();
      if (qContainingClass != null
          && isReceiverType(functionalInterfaceType, containingClass, (PsiMethod) resolve)) {
        subst = TypeConversionUtil.getClassSubstitutor(containingClass, qContainingClass, subst);
        LOG.assertTrue(subst != null);
      }

      final PsiType interfaceReturnType =
          LambdaUtil.getFunctionalInterfaceReturnType(functionalInterfaceType);

      PsiType returnType =
          PsiTypesUtil.patchMethodGetClassReturnType(
              expression,
              expression,
              (PsiMethod) resolve,
              null,
              PsiUtil.getLanguageLevel(expression));
      if (returnType == null) {
        returnType = ((PsiMethod) resolve).getReturnType();
      }
      PsiType methodReturnType = subst.substitute(returnType);
      if (interfaceReturnType != null && interfaceReturnType != PsiType.VOID) {
        if (methodReturnType == null) {
          methodReturnType =
              JavaPsiFacade.getElementFactory(expression.getProject())
                  .createType(containingClass, subst);
        }
        if (!TypeConversionUtil.isAssignable(interfaceReturnType, methodReturnType, false)) {
          return "Bad return type in method reference: cannot convert "
              + methodReturnType.getCanonicalText()
              + " to "
              + interfaceReturnType.getCanonicalText();
        }
      }
    }
    return null;
  }
